Ronan Funeral Home - CarlisleJAMES W. INGOLD
James W. Ingold, 77, of Harrisburg, passed away on Tuesday, October 7, 2025 at Spring Creek Rehabilitation and Nursing Center.
Born February 23, 1948 in McKeesport, PA, he was the son of the late James G. And Ella H. (Goon) Ingold.
James grew up in Cannonsburg and graduated from Cannon-McMillen High School and attended the University of Pittsburgh. He was a U S Navy veteran, having served during the Vietnam era, where he specialized in Satellite Telemetry. After his Naval service, he was a government contractor, particularly with NASA, traveling all over the world.
He loved football, especially the Pittsburgh Steelers, the ocean and fishing.
Surviving are his wife: Graciela Becher of Mechanicsburg, a son, James B. Ingold (Julissa) and daughter Joscelyn Ingold, both of Carlisle. He is also survived by a sister, Linda Lane and a brother, Fritz Ingold, both of New York, as well as three grandchildren, Brandon, Mery and Julie Ingold and many nieces and nephews.
Memorial Mass will be held on Friday, October 24, 2025 at 11:00 AM at St. Patrick Catholic Church, 85 Marsh Drive, Carlisle, with Rev. Donald Bender celebrating. Private burial will take place in Florida at a later date. Military honors will be provided by the Cumberland County Honor Guard.
